Depth Of Information:
Covers operational use, basic checks, fluid specifications, and general maintenance advice. It does not typically include detailed repair procedures, diagnostic codes, or component-level disassembly/reassembly instructions, which are found in service manuals.

Common W203 Issues:
The W203 platform is known for potential issues with the 'Balance Shaft' recall on earlier M271 engines (not applicable to the V6 M112), SRS warning light due to faulty occupant classification system sensors or seat occupancy mat, and occasional sagging headliner. Some models may experience premature wear on suspension components.
